Description
Description:Job Summary:
Responsible for the delivery of psychiatric nursing care/services to members being treated in the behavioral health service departments. Positions assigned to this classification are characterized by providing interventions that: promote and foster health; assess dysfuntion; assist patients to regain or improve their coping abilities; maximize patient strengths and prevent further disability. These interventions focus on the psychiatric-mental health patient and include: health promotion and health maintenance; monitoring patients and assisting them with self-care activities; monitoring psycho-biological treatment regimens; providing triage decisions and facilitating patient movement into appropriate services.
Essential Responsibilities:
- Coordinates with pharmacy regarding approved medications.
- Provides information and education to members in a variety of forums.
- Documents Services rendered utilizing standard nursing procedures in member chart.
- Triage phone calls and refer to appropriate staff or community resources.
- Assist Psychiatrists with coordinating internal and external hospitalizations of members.
- Performs basic physical assessments of patients including vital signs and monitoring for side effects of psychiatric active medications and referring information to physicians as appropriate.
- Provides prescribed medications to patients per physicians orders following appropriate protocol.
- Utilizes electronic medical record for medication refills.
- Reviews lab results and refers to physician within protocols and guidelines.
- Performs other duties as assigned by the Department Administrator and/or Chief of Psychiatry.
